Origins and Evolution
The dumbwaiter, originally known as a “lazy waiter,” has its roots in the ancient world. Early civilizations, including the Greeks and Romans, used rudimentary systems of pulleys and ropes to move goods between floors. These systems were primarily manual and required human effort to operate.

As the centuries progressed, the design and functionality of the dumbwaiter evolved. By the 19th century, with the advent of industrialization, dumbwaiters became more sophisticated. They were commonly found in large homes, restaurants, and hotels, serving as silent assistants that efficiently transported items from one floor to another.

Mechanics of a Dumbwaiter

At its core, a dumbwaiter is a marvel of engineering, seamlessly blending mechanical principles with modern technology. But how exactly does this compact elevator work? Let’s delve into the mechanics of a dumbwaiter.

Manual vs. Electric Dumbwaiters

  1. Manual Dumbwaiters: These are operated using a hand pulley system. The user pulls a rope or handle to move the car up or down. Counterweights can be added to balance the load, making it easier to operate.
  2. Electric Dumbwaiters: These are powered by electric motors. With the push of a button, the motor engages, moving the car to the desired floor. Advanced models come with safety features like automatic stops and emergency brakes.

DIY vs. Professional Installation

The decision to install a dumbwaiter often leads to another crucial choice: Should you take the DIY route or hire professionals? Both options come with their own set of advantages and challenges. Let’s delve into the pros and cons of each to help you make an informed decision.

DIY Dumbwaiter Installation

Advantages:

  1. Cost Savings: Going the DIY route can save on labor costs associated with professional installation.
  2. Personal Customization: You have complete control over the design, materials, and features, allowing for a personalized touch.
  3. Learning Experience: It’s an opportunity to learn and understand the mechanics of the dumbwaiter, which can be beneficial for future maintenance.

Challenges:

  1. Time-Consuming: Without professional experience, the installation process can be lengthy.
  2. Potential Mistakes: Errors in installation can lead to malfunctions or safety risks.
  3. Lack of Warranty: DIY installations might not come with the warranties that professional services offer.

Professional Dumbwaiter Installation

Advantages:

  1. Expertise: Professionals bring experience and knowledge, ensuring the installation is done correctly and safely.
  2. Time-Efficiency: With their expertise, professionals can complete the installation faster than a DIY approach.
  3. Warranty and Support: Most professional installations come with warranties and post-installation support.
  4. Safety Assurance: Professionals are aware of safety standards and regulations, ensuring the dumbwaiter is compliant.

Challenges:

  1. Higher Initial Cost: Hiring professionals can be more expensive due to labor and service charges.
  2. Scheduling: You’ll need to coordinate with the installation company’s schedule, which might not always align with yours.

Factors to Consider:

  1. Budget: Assess your budget to determine if you can afford professional installation or if DIY is more feasible.
  2. Skill Level: Consider your technical skills and experience with similar projects.
  3. Safety: If you’re unsure about any aspect of the installation, especially safety protocols, it’s best to seek professional help.
  4. Long-Term Maintenance: Think about future maintenance needs. Understanding the installation process can be beneficial for DIY repairs, but professional installations often come with support services.


Whether you choose DIY or professional installation for your residential dumbwaiter, the key is to prioritize safety and functionality. While DIY offers a sense of accomplishment and potential cost savings, professional services provide peace of mind with their expertise and support. Assess your individual needs, budget, and comfort level to make the best choice for your home.
